Baked Tortilla Chips

Crispy, wholesome tortilla chips made by baking thin-cut whole wheat tortilla strips until golden and crunchy. A simple, lighter alternative to fried chips that takes just minutes to prepare. Perfect as a snack on its own or paired with your favorite dips.

Ingredients
3 Whole wheat flour tortillas (10-inch), 3 tortillas
3 sprays Cooking oil spray, 3 sprays
Salt, to taste (optional)
Directions
Preheat your oven to 400°F. Lightly coat a baking sheet with one spray of cooking oil to prevent sticking.
Stack the tortillas and cut each one into 8 equal wedges, as if slicing a pizza. Arrange all wedges in a single layer on the prepared baking sheet.
Lightly spray the top surface of each tortilla wedge with cooking oil—use the remaining 2 sprays distributed evenly across all pieces.
Season with a light sprinkle of salt if desired.
Bake for 10 minutes, checking around the 8-minute mark. The chips are done when they are crisp and light golden brown. Remove from the oven and let cool on the pan for a few minutes—they will continue to crisp as they cool. Serve immediately or store in an airtight container.
